De hecho, un parque offshore compuesto por 30 aerogeneradores SG 14-222 DD servir\u00eda para cubrir el consumo anual de electricidad de una ciudad con una poblaci\u00f3n similar a la de Bilbao.<\/p>\n<p>El nuevo aerogenerador est\u00e1 equipado con un rotor de 222 metros de di\u00e1metro. Cada una de sus tres palas de 108 metros de longitud es tan larga como un campo de f\u00fatbol. A pesar de su gran tama\u00f1o, estas palas se funden en una sola pieza utilizando tecnolog\u00edas de palas patentadas de Siemens Gamesa. El aumento en el tama\u00f1o del rotor permite un incremento del 25% en la producci\u00f3n anual de energ\u00eda en comparaci\u00f3n con el modelo anterior, el SG 11.0-200 DD.<\/p>\n<p>Adem\u00e1s, la compa\u00f1\u00eda ha aligerado el peso de la nacelle hasta las 500 toneladas. Esto le permite aumentar su competitividad , reducir los costes en materiales y en necesidades de transporte, as\u00ed como utilizar una torre y cimentaci\u00f3n optimizadas frente a aerogeneradores m\u00e1s pesados.<\/p>\n<p>La \u00faltima incorporaci\u00f3n a la cartera de producto offshore de Siemens Gamesase aprovecha la experiencia y tecnolog\u00eda ya probada de las cinco generaciones anteriores de productos direct drive. Desde su lanzamiento en 2011, Siemens Gamesa ha instalado m\u00e1s de 1.000 aerogeneradores offshore con esta tecnolog\u00eda en los principales mercados mundiales: Reino Unido, Alemania, Dinamarca, Holanda, B\u00e9lgica o Taiw\u00e1n, entre otros. Adem\u00e1s, la compa\u00f1\u00eda cuenta con pedidos para la instalaci\u00f3n de otras 1.000 turbinas en los pr\u00f3ximos a\u00f1os, algunos de los cuales llegar\u00e1n por primera vez a mercados como Estados Unidos o Francia.<\/p>\n<p><img decoding=\"async\" class=\" size-full wp-image-15673\" style=\"display: block; margin-left: auto; margin-right: auto;\" src=\"https:\/\/aeeolica.org\/wp-content\/uploads\/2020\/05\/Turbine-Beauty-Shots-dreiviertel-2_0042-scaled.jpg\" alt=\"\" width=\"750\" height=\"422\" \/><\/p>\n","protected":false},"excerpt":{"rendered":"<p>Siemens Gamesa ha lanzado su nuevo modelo de aerogenerador marino SG 14-222 DD.
